  • Pineapple Hospitality When Brett Magnan was hired to oversee a complete renovation of the Maxwell Hotel in Seattle, he had six months of work ahead of him...and only three months to complete it.

    "I was brought in at the last minute and we were up against a firm deadline," says Magnan, Director of Development & Operations at CherryTree Hospitality Management. "We needed everything from amenity dispensers to trash cans, and had limited time and a limited budget to finish up. Using the relationships I've built through the years at BITAC, I picked up the phone and leveraged my suppliers, pulled some strings, and called in favors to get things done."
     
    "The hotel reopened on time and on budget. I couldn't have done it without BITAC."
     
    Presented by Hotel Interactive, BITAC – the Buyer Interactive Trade Alliance & Conference – has been rated as the #1 event in the hospitality industry…and it’s easy to see why.
     
    Unlike traditional conferences or trade shows, BITAC doesn’t focus on walking a show floor to see who has the flashiest booth. At BITAC, buyers and suppliers are matched up for pre-qualified one-on-one meetings. Cutting-edge interactive educational sessions keep you up-to-date on the latest industry news and trends. There are also many more networking opportunities available – such as relationship building dinners and peanut butter & jelly challenges – providing additional access to some of the industry’s top decision-makers.
     
    “Ever since I started attending BITAC, it has continued to be a great tool for networking,” says Magnan. “I know suppliers on a first name basis, and use the contacts I’ve made as a resource for every hotel I'm working with. During projects like the one at the Maxwell, every system, every purchase came from a relationship I created at BITAC.”
     
    BITAC’s proprietary scheduling system arranges meetings based on the buyer’s product needs and the supplier’s product offering. Buyers are scheduled with suppliers they may be familiar with as well as suppliers that they may not have the chance to visit at a typical trade show.
     
    “It would be impractical, if not impossible to recreate the one-on-one opportunities you get to meet with executives from independent and large corporate brands that you do at BITAC,” says Ray Burger, President of Pineapple Hospitality – the premier distributor of Greener Products and Marketing Programs for the Hospitality Industry.
     
    “I know I’ve accomplished more in just a few days at a BITAC event than I could by spending countless hours and thousands of dollars flying across the country for individual meetings,” Burger adds.

    For Magnan, sometimes he attends a specific BITAC event to build relationships and get new ideas. Other times, he’s in search of a specific product or supplier for one of his hotel projects.
     
    For instance, one of his properties was undergoing a complete renovation – going from a 1 star to a 3.5-star property. The furniture at the hotel was old and outdated, but at BITAC he found a connection to The Refinishing Touch. A longtime Pineapple partner, The Refinishing Touch provides environmentally safe, on-site furniture modification and reupholstery.
     
    “They were able to take the old furniture and completely rework it so that it looked brand new,” says Magnan. “We stayed under budget, the designs look fantastic, and no one knows that it isn’t brand new.”
     
    Other times, relationships pop up completely unexpectedly.
     
    “Sometimes I find a company does something that I didn’t know they could do,” says Magnan. “You get preconceived notions about what a company does and you may not realize the full extent of their product offerings.”
     
    Magnan says that he had recently furnished a hotel with new televisions, so he didn’t think anything would come from a meeting set up through BITAC with Real TV. He didn’t initially realize that they were a television content provider.
     
    “If I had I blown the meeting off, I would have missed something valuable,” he says.
